A counterexample is an example that disproves a statement or proposition. For instance, the statement 'Every prime number is an odd number' is disproved by the counterexample '2', which is a prime number but not odd.

What is the converse of a conditional statement?
Back
The converse of a conditional statement 'If P, then Q' is 'If Q, then P'. For example, the converse of 'If it is night, then it is dark outside' is 'If it is dark outside, then it is night'.

What is the Supplements Theorem?
Back
The Supplements Theorem states that if two angles are supplementary to the same angle (or to congruent angles), then they are congruent to each other.

What is a biconditional statement?
Back
A biconditional statement is a statement that combines a conditional statement and its converse, written as 'P if and only if Q'. It is true when both the original statement and the converse are true.

What does it mean for angles to be supplementary?
Back
Two angles are supplementary if the sum of their measures is 180 degrees.

What is a conditional statement?
Back
A conditional statement is an 'if-then' statement that expresses a relationship between two propositions, typically written as 'If P, then Q'.

What is the contrapositive of a conditional statement?
Back
The contrapositive of a conditional statement 'If P, then Q' is 'If not Q, then not P'. It is logically equivalent to the original statement.
